WBU Golf Open Season with WBU Fall Invite
Tyler Parr and Kendra Harness each brought home runner-up finishes as the Williams Baptist University men's and women's golf teams kicked off the 2022-23 season with the WBU Fall Invite played at the Kennett Country Club in Kennett, Mo.
Parr helped the Eagles to a third-place finish by firing a two-day of 602, which included a final round of 4-under-par 68. He was edged out for medalist honors by Central Baptist College's Jakup Slapal who turned in a tournament low of 140 to help led the Mustangs to the men's title.
CBC had two-day total of 584 to finish 16 shots ahead of Missouri Baptist who turned in a score of 600. Williams was third with a team score of 602, while Lyon College "A" was fourth at 605. Crowley's Ridge College turned in a 637 to take fifth and Lyon College "B' rounded out the team scoring with a 679.
Other scores for WBU included Thibau DeLange with a 148, Dawson McMahan at 154, Quinn Crosskno at 158 and Carrington Reed 159. Kaleb McClain, who played as an individual, carded a 163.
In the women's tournament, CBC captured the team title with a two-day score of 687, while Lyon finished second with a total of 796. Lyon Sydney Czanstkowski won the individual title with two-round total of 155, while Harness was four strokes behind at 159.
Leslie Hill carded a two-day score of 175, while Grace Woody had a score of 186.
WBU returns to the links Sept. 25-26 in Batesville, Ark., for the Lyon College Fall Invitational.
